Why we built Chalk

One-to-one teaching can make a real difference.

But it isn’t equally available to every learner.

  • 20.8%

    of pupils in England have special educational needs

  • 538,500

    children with an Education, Health and Care Plan

  • 1.3 million

    more receiving SEN support

A teacher with thirty children cannot always stop for one, and private tutoring runs to tens of pounds an hour. Most families cannot do that every week.

For many SEND learners the usual tools add barriers of their own: dense text, one fixed pace, little room to pause or repeat. General-purpose chatbots have not fixed that. They make a finished answer very easy to get. But being given an answer isn’t the same as learning how to reach it.

So Chalk is a SEND-first learning platform. SEND shapes how it speaks, what it puts on screen, how fast it goes and how it guides, rather than being a setting added to a general-purpose tutor. It is built to teach: explaining, asking, hinting and letting learners work things out.

Is my child's data used to train AI?

Never. Lessons are stored so that you and your child can look back at them, and for nothing else at all. We do not sell data and we do not train models on it. You can export or delete everything at any time.

What exactly do you store?

The topic, what Chalk said, what your child answered, the sources used, and the time and date. No microphone recordings are kept. Speech is turned into text and the audio is discarded.

What happens if my child says something worrying?

The lesson stops immediately and cannot be restarted from that screen. Your child sees a calm page with the Childline number and a prompt to talk to a trusted adult, and the lesson is flagged in Past Lessons.

Does it work if my child can't or won't speak?

Yes. Every part of a lesson can be typed instead. Typing is always available beside the microphone.
